Output d1346cd436bf33cef633805072ef17cf5f7d5e01885f65d40497541ed03393c2:52

value
67302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d423f072413ef3eb779fa4721b2029b8dfb788df OP_EQUAL
address
3M2iEKBFwSADuzQBeGzCySYUKC1dvgWo1F
transaction
d1346cd436bf33cef633805072ef17cf5f7d5e01885f65d40497541ed03393c2
confirmations
244617
spent
true